. Pigeons can be a nuisance on balconies, and one of the most effective ways to deter them is by removing food sources. Pigeons are attracted to balconies with food debris, pet food, and bird seed. To discourage pigeons from visiting your balcony, make sure to clean up any food waste, store pet food in sealed containers, and avoid feeding other birds on your balcony. Additionally, consider using bird feeders that are designed to exclude pigeons, such as those with weight-activated perches or cage-like enclosures. By removing food sources, you can make your balcony less appealing to pigeons and encourage them to find alternative locations to forage for food. Regularly cleaning your balcony and removing any potential food sources will also help to reduce the attractiveness of your balcony to pigeons. Furthermore, consider using a motion-activated sprinkler or ultrasonic bird repeller to scare pigeons away from your balcony. These devices can be an effective deterrent, especially when used in conjunction with removing food sources. By taking these steps, you can help to get rid of pigeons on your balcony and prevent them from becoming a nuisance.

. Pigeons can be a nuisance on balconies, and one of the most effective ways to deter them is by using visual deterrents. These can include shiny reflective surfaces, predator decoys, and balloons. The idea behind these visual deterrents is to create an environment that pigeons find uncomfortable or threatening, causing them to avoid the area altogether. For example, pigeons are naturally wary of predators such as hawks and owls, so placing a decoy of one of these birds on the balcony can be an effective way to scare them away. Similarly, shiny reflective surfaces such as aluminum foil or CDs can create a sense of unease in pigeons, making them less likely to roost on the balcony. Balloons can also be used to create a sense of movement and unpredictability, which can be unsettling for pigeons. By using a combination of these visual deterrents, you can create a pigeon-free zone on your balcony. Additionally, it's also important to note that visual deterrents can be used in conjunction with other methods, such as removing food sources and using noise-making devices, to create a comprehensive pigeon control plan. By taking a multi-faceted approach, you can effectively get rid of pigeons on your balcony and enjoy a pigeon-free outdoor space.
